Abstract

The utility model relates to the technical field of power grid line maintenance, in particular to a medium-voltage distribution line state indicating system, which comprises a shell and a main body module arranged in the shell, wherein the main body module is provided with a main board, a controller and a display module, the controller is arranged on the main board, and the display module is connected with the controller; the power supply module is arranged in the shell and provides working power supply for the state indicating system; the switching control module is arranged in the shell and connected with the controller to realize manual control and remote control of the state indicating system; the remote controller is matched with the controller to control the state indicating system; and the key control module is arranged on the shell and is connected with the controller. Background
At present, when a line is overhauled or power is transferred in the aspect of maintaining a medium-voltage distribution network of a power supply station of a power grid company, a tag is required to be hung according to the requirements of an industry standard so as to indicate the running condition of the line or a switch. However, in actual work, the types of the nameplates are multiple, the number of the power distribution cabinets is large, the number of the nameplates is not enough or the number of a certain nameplate is not enough, the condition that the nameplates are forgotten or missed can also occur in emergency due to time in the fault repairing process, the missed condition and the missed condition are caused to make the operation condition of the next worker to the equipment unclear, the misoperation can cause line misstop, misdelivery or misgrounding, the power grid equipment is damaged, or even serious personal casualty accidents occur, and the burden and the cost of a company are increased.

Example 1:
as shown in fig. 1, the utility model provides a middling pressure distribution lines state indicating system, including the casing, casing and equipment fixed connection are equipped with main part module in the casing, main part module is equipped with mainboard and controller, on the mainboard was located to the controller, display module is connected with the controller, display module is pilot lamp and display screen, pilot lamp and display screen carry out information display under the control action of controller, show the operating condition of equipment, for example, realize the running state through the scintillation and remind, the running state of the audio-visual display device of display screen. The displayed information comprises three types, namely: the circuit is operated in an operating state without a power supply, switching-on and switching-off are forbidden, the circuit works by people, and the prompt effect is played for the working personnel through the switching of the display information.
The power module is arranged in the shell, provides power for the operation of the equipment and maintains the normal work of the equipment.
And the switching control module is arranged in the shell and is connected with the controller, the switching control module is operated, and the manual control and the remote control of the state indicating system are switched.
When the state indicating system is arranged at a high place or a position where workers cannot easily reach, the switching control module is controlled to switch the working state of the state indicating system to a remote control mode, and the workers remotely control the controller through the remote controller to realize information switching of the display module.
When the installation position of the state indicating system is convenient for a worker to manually control, the control switching control module switches the working state of the state indicating system to be manual, the shell is provided with the key control module, the key control module is connected with the controller, the key control module is provided with keys corresponding to all functions, and the corresponding functions are realized by controlling the keys corresponding to the functions.
The staff switches the display information through manually controlling the state indicating system, or the staff can switch the working state of the state indicating system into remote control through the switching control module, and the staff remotely controls the controller through the remote controller to realize the information switching of the display module.
The remote controller is provided with a signal generator, the main body module is provided with a signal receiver, the signal receiver is connected with the controller, the signal generator of the remote controller sends a signal to the signal receiver, the controller receives the signal and controls the indicator lamp and the display screen to display information for switching.
In this embodiment, the state indicating system is further provided with an electric storage module, the electric storage module is a storage battery with a charging and discharging function, and the electric storage module cooperates with the power supply module to supply power to the device.
In this embodiment, the status indication system is further provided with a signal acquisition module, and the signal acquisition module is connected with the controller. The state indicating system is connected with a power distribution cabinet provided with an automatic switch, the signal acquisition module is used for acquiring the opening and closing states of the automatic switch, acquiring information of the power distribution cabinet and displaying the information through an indicating lamp and a display screen so as to assist a line operation and maintenance worker to more clearly master the operation state of the automatic switch or the line.
The main part module is equipped with the reset key, and the reset key is connected with the controller, can reset by a key when the state indicating system appears the system disorder, resumes as before. Mainboard and controller are equipped with the waterproof layer, and the waterproof layer can avoid moisture to get into mainboard and controller, ensures mainboard and controller normal work. Still be equipped with waterproof stripe on the gap of casing, waterproof stripe enables state indicating system and is difficult for receiving the harm of external adverse circumstances.
